On my EEE 701 with a 4Gig SSD, I avoided the problem of exceeding the
write exhaustion by installing on an SDHC card instead.  If that
eventually fails from too many writes, i can buy another one.

My EEE 1005 has a spinning hard disk so the problem is absent.  I also
have an Intel Classmate, but its SSD is only 2Gig, you-dumb-too needs
4gig, and I am had trouble finding a compatibly connectable larger
version.  I'll probably eventually go the SDHC route with it as well
(it's otherwise comparable spec-wise to the EEE 701).

OpenWrt is quite good about avoiding writes to media.  OpenWrt has X,
might be fun to try to install on the Classmate, but I am not
suggesting that Denis do that, as the user experience would be quite
different.
